Water Quality Summary

St George has 14 health-based violations on record, meaning one or more contaminants were found above EPA-established safe levels. Contaminants involved: Chlorine Dioxide, Gross Alpha, HAA5, Total Organic Carbon. In total, 31 violations are on record for 2 water systems serving 492 people.
